short-sighted Thai Translation

short-sighted - ซึ่งไม่มองการณ์ไกล

EnglishThaiTransliteration
short-sighted
(Adjective)
ซึ่งไม่มองการณ์ไกล
Related:ซึ่งมองหรือคิดอะไรตื้นๆ